STAND, SURGICAL INSTRUM
Solicitation # SPE2DH-26-T-6685
Solicitation SPE2DH-26-T-6685, issued by the DLA Troop Support Medical Supply Chain FSH, seeks quotes for one stainless steel foot-operated surgical instrument stand under NAICS code 331313. The required stand must be adjustable from 39.5 to 62 inches, feature an automatic locking device, and include casters. It must be constructed from corrosion-resistant stainless steel and include a foot-operated control button with a protective guard to prevent accidental release. Bidders are required to specify the source and part number of the item being supplied. The item is not regulated by the FDA. The contract is a fixed-price acquisition with a required delivery date of September 14, 2026, to be shipped via the fastest traceable means to destinations in Gulfport and Pascagoula, Mississippi. Packaging must adhere to RP001 DLA requirements and commercial standards, while marking must comply with Medical Marking Standard No. 1. Inspection and acceptance will occur at the destination. All quotes must be submitted through the DIBBS system by September 17, 2026. The agreement incorporates various FAR and DFARS clauses, including requirements for combating trafficking in persons, safeguarding covered defense information, and compliance with the Buy American Act and Berry Amendment. Payment processing will be handled electronically via the Wide Area WorkFlow system.

The contract requires the procurement of 2 packaging groups (PG) of disposal containers measuring 1.25 inches by 6 inches, specifically the Sharps Shuttle P2 model with NSN 6530-01-619-5671, to be delivered within 20 days as directed by order to Quantico, Virginia, 22134-5036, with FOB Destination terms placing all transportation costs and risks on the contractor. The containers must comply with DLA’s RP001 packaging standards and be packed and labeled according to MIL-STD-129 or, for medical items, the Medical Marking Standard No. 1, which supersedes MIL-STD-129 for this acquisition; packaging must further meet ASTM D3951 requirements unless overridden by the DLA Master List of Technical and Quality Requirements, referenced via R and I numbers. The solicitation, issued under SPE2DH-26-T-3788, mandates full compliance with DFARS clauses including safeguarding covered defense information, cyber incident reporting, prohibited procurement of certain telecommunications equipment, and NIST SP 800-171 assessment requirements for cybersecurity compliance, alongside FAR provisions such as destination inspection and equal opportunity. Offerors must disclose their UEI and CAGE code, provide socioeconomic certifications if applicable, and submit hazard warning labels for any hazardous materials not regulated under FIFRA, FFDCA, TSCA, CAA, or CWA. All proposals must be submitted electronically via DIBBS by May 18, 2026, using the WAWF system for invoicing and receiving reports, and the contract type remains to be specified by the Contracting Officer under FAR 52.216-1 or its alternate. Pricing details are not provided in the solicitation, and no evaluation factors, weights, or basis of award are stated, leaving price and technical acceptability as implicit criteria for selection.
